2. **Durability and Longevity** LED headlights have a much longer lifespan than traditional halogen bulbs, often lasting **20,000 50,000 hours** compared to 1,000 2,000 hours for halogens. This reduces maintenance costs and replacement frequency.
3. **Energy Efficiency** LEDs consume far less power than halogens, which can be beneficial if you re running aftermarket lighting on a bike with limited electrical capacity. The lower heat output also reduces the risk of melting plastic components.
